Factors Affecting Cost
- Material Type: The choice of materials, such as concrete, asphalt, or pavers, will significantly impact the overall cost.
- Ramp Size: Larger ramps require more materials and labor, increasing the total expense.
- Slope and Grade: Steeper slopes may require additional engineering and materials, raising the cost.
- Labor Rates: Local labor costs in Dacula, GA, can vary and will affect the final price.
- Permits and Inspections: Obtaining necessary permits and passing inspections can add to the overall cost.
- Site Preparation: The condition of the existing driveway and the need for excavation or grading will influence the cost.
- Customization: Adding features like handrails or decorative elements can increase expenses.
Common Tasks and Costs
Task | Average Cost (Dacula, GA) |
---|---|
Concrete Ramp Installation | $1,200 - $2,500 |
Asphalt Ramp Installation | $1,000 - $2,000 |
Paver Ramp Installation | $1,500 - $3,000 |
Excavation and Grading | $500 - $1,500 |
Permit Fees | $100 - $300 |
Handrail Installation | $200 - $500 |
Decorative Elements | $300 - $700 |
